From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 [gcide]:

  Euthiochroic \Eu`thi*o*chro"ic\, a. [Gr. e'y^ well + ? sulphur +
     ? color.] (Chem.)
     Pertaining to, or denoting, an acid so called.
     [1913 Webster]
  
     {Euthiochroic acid} (Chem.), a complex derivative of


        hydroquinone and sulphonic (thionic) acid. -- so called
        because it contains sulphur, and forms brilliantly colored
        (yellow) salts.
        [1913 Webster]
